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

A3 Sportback

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.

Audi A3 Sportback is a bit cheaper – starting at 27,000 £ , while the Renault Austral costs 29,900 £ . That’s a price difference of around 2,914 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Audi A3 Sportback uses 1.1 L/100km and is substantially more efficient than the Renault Austral with 6.4 L/100km. The difference is about 5.3 L/100km.

Austral

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Audi A3 Sportback offers clearly more power – delivering 400 HP compared to 148 HP. That’s roughly 252 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Audi A3 Sportback is significantly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.8 s, while the Renault Austral takes 9.9 s. That’s about 6.1 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Audi A3 Sportback delivers considerably more torque with 500 Nm compared to 270 Nm. That’s about 230 Nm more.

A3 Sportback

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, Audi A3 Sportback is a bit lighter – 1,360 kg compared to 1,548 kg. The difference is around 188 kg.

When it comes to payload, the Audi A3 Sportback carries marginally more – 480 kg compared to 455 kg. That’s a difference of about 25 kg.

Audi A3 Sportback

The Audi A3 Sportback wraps premium materials and crisp German design into a practical hatchback package that makes daily driving feel smart rather than showy. It’s nimble in the city, composed on longer trips, and carries just enough swagger to satisfy buyers who want quality without shouting about it.

details

Renault Austral

The Renault Austral is a stylish, well-built crossover that blends a comfortable ride with a spacious, modern cabin. It combines everyday-friendly refinement and contemporary technology with a focus on safety and practicality, making it a sensible choice for drivers who want an all-round family car.
